I’ve started incorporating a daily shot of extra virgin olive oil with a squeeze of lemon.
Now, I’m not saying this is going to make your skin glow or magically reduce inflammation on its own. But we do know that extra virgin olive oil is a staple of the Mediterranean diet—a dietary pattern consistently associated with heart health and other long-term health benefits.
Here’s why I include it:
❤️ Supports heart health as part of an overall healthy diet.
💊 Helps your body absorb fat-soluble vitamins like A, D, E, and K.
🥗 Healthy fats can help you feel fuller after meals.
🌿 High-quality extra virgin olive oil contains polyphenols—natural plant compounds with antioxidant properties that help protect your body’s cells from oxidative stress. Some polyphenols, like oleocanthal, may also help support a healthy inflammatory response.
🍋 The lemon? Honestly… I just like the taste. 😂
For me, this isn’t about finding a miracle product. It’s about building small, sustainable habits that support my health over time.

If you’re looking to add one product to your body skincare routine, this is the body retinol I reach for again and again.
As we get older, our skin naturally changes. It can become rougher, drier, and lose some of its glow. A body retinol can help improve the look of texture, uneven skin tone, and overall skin quality over time.
✨ My tip? Start slowly—2 to 3 nights a week—and always follow with a moisturizer.
And don’t forget your sunscreen! Retinol and SPF are a team.

The secret isn’t just waxing… it’s what you do after.
If you’re over 35, collagen production is slowing down and skin turnover isn’t what it used to be. A few simple habits can make your skin look smoother, brighter, and healthier all summer long.
✨ Wait 72 hours before exfoliating.
✨ Add a body retinol a few nights a week.
✨ Moisturize daily.
✨ Wear SPF (yes, on your body too).
✨ Leave ingrown hairs alone.
Your skin will thank you.

While everyone was focused on the drama, Liz McGraw and Dolores Catania were helping shine a light on something that affects millions of women.
Rhode Island just became the first state in the nation to require workplace accommodations for women experiencing perimenopause and menopause-related conditions. That’s a huge deal.
